Rana culaiensis Li, Lu, and Li, 2008

Class: Amphibia > Order: Anura > Family: Ranidae > Genus: Rana

[link to this account]

Rana culaiensis Li, Lu, and Li, 2008, Asiat. Herpetol. Res., 11: 63. Holotype: YT 050526007, by original designation. Type locality: "Mt. Culai (117° 18′ E, 36° 02′ N), Taian City, Shandong province, China . . ., at 900 m elevation".

English Names

None noted.

Distribution

Known only from the type locality (Mt. Culai, Taian City, Shandong Province, China, 900 m elevation).

Comment

In the Rana longicrus group according to the original publication. See comments by Yan, Jiang, Chen, Fang, Jin, Li, Wang, Murphy, and Zhang, 2011, Asian Herpetol. Res., Ser. 2, 2: 67.
